Understanding Software Development Methodologies: A Comprehensive Overview

2 min read

Exploring software development methodologies is essential for achieving success in any project. Whether you're drawn to the adaptable nature of Agile or prefer the structured approach of Waterfall, having a solid understanding of each methodology is crucial for making informed decisions. At the Zaigo Infotech blog, we offer a comprehensive guide that delves into the intricacies of various software development methodologies.

Our guide covers popular methodologies such as Agile, Scrum, and Kanban, providing readers with a detailed analysis of their principles, practices, and real-world applications. By exploring these methodologies, readers can gain valuable insights into how each approach can be tailored to suit the unique requirements of their projects.

For those considering Agile, our guide provides a deep dive into its iterative nature, emphasizing the importance of collaboration, flexibility, and customer feedback. We highlight the key principles of the Agile Manifesto and showcase how Agile frameworks such as Scrum and Kanban can be implemented to drive efficiency and innovation.

On the other hand, for teams leaning towards a more traditional approach, our analysis of the Waterfall methodology sheds light on its sequential structure, with distinct phases for requirements gathering, design, development, testing, and deployment. We discuss the benefits and challenges of Waterfall, offering practical insights for mitigating risks and ensuring project success.

Moreover, our guide goes beyond the basics to explore hybrid methodologies and emerging trends in software development, such as DevOps and Lean practices. We provide readers with the tools and knowledge needed to navigate the ever-evolving landscape of software development methodologies effectively.

By exploring the detailed analysis of software development methodologies offered at the Zaigo Infotech blog, readers can deepen their understanding of these approaches and their implications for project management. You'll deepen your understanding of software development methodology and its implications for projects. Equip yourself with the knowledge needed to navigate methodologies effectively.

 

In case you have found a mistake in the text, please send a message to the author by selecting the mistake and pressing Ctrl-Enter.
kelly williams 2
Joined: 2 weeks ago
Comments (0)

    No comments yet

You must be logged in to comment.

Sign In / Sign Up